A sportsbook is a gambling establishment that accepts wagers on various events and provides betting options for its customers. The industry is highly regulated, and there are certain laws and requirements that must be met in order to run a legal sportsbook. This can include a variety of factors, such as responsible gambling and anti-addiction measures. It is important to understand the requirements of your jurisdiction before opening a sportsbook, as this will help you avoid any potential issues down the road.
